Horseshoe Lake: Considered one of the best local paddling destinations by members of the Spokane Canoe and Kayak Club, this no-wake lake in Pend Oreille County has a WDFW boat launch. It’s a designated no-wake lake with a 5 mph speed limit located in Pend Oreille County 4 miles north of the Spokane County line to the west of Highway 2. Brittany Preischel... Lake Spokane (Long Lake): Paddling launch points and swimming beaches are located at Riverside State Park’s Nine Mile Recreation Area and Lake Spokane Campground.
